Packaging Technologist

Kingston upon Hull, East Yorkshire

Competitive Salary & excellent benefits package

Closing Date 15th December 2023


Working within the New Growth Platforms (NGP) team you will be focused on our European, Asia and Middle East Portfolio.

Area of focus within this team would be on Hygiene and Health, to name few key brands they would be (though not limited to) Dettol, Finish, Harpic, Airwick, Lysol footprints across surface care and personal care.


Within this role you will ensure:

  • All packaging elements are delivered within budget and to agreed set timescales (accordingly to SOPs and internal systems)
  • Detailed project success criteria are in place for all projects and each aspect fulfilled
  • Provide technical inputs into design briefs and that the selected designs meet the product success criteria.
  • Build effective working relationships with internal partners for example: marketing, trade, legal, regulatory, medical, R&D, regional packaging teams, engineering, quality, procurement and external partners for example: suppliers, tool makers, design agencies, test houses, universities, creative agencies
  • Manage pilot tool qualification ensuring packaging to be fit for purpose and to meet set KPI's
  • Support Production Tool qualification & Line validation on need basis
  • Take part in Gross margin improvement and Sustainability programs
  • To identify and evaluate new developments or trends which could be considered in the GBS business and this could include innovation, technologies, materials and processes
  • Ensure all new product developments are compliant and adhere to the requirements from other work stream such as: Formulation, Regulatory, Medical, Quality

Do you have:


  • Degree in Packaging Engineering or related scientific field
  • Demonstrated competence and proven track record of success within Healthcare/FMCG environment
  • Knowledge of injection and blow moulding mandatory. Knowledge about other technologies is an advantage
  • Knowledge of Manufacturing technology (both on the making of the packaging components as well as the related filling and packing technology)
  • Knowledge of relevant packaging legislation, regulations and standards
  • Understanding of Intellectual Property issues associated with structural packaging design
  • Experience in handling multiple NPD's successfully.
  • Demonstrated ability to take initiative, think and work independently, problemsolve, work in teams and multitask.
